Transaction 51b56c734b002fc1e91702e4a2b9c3b0bb55b51fa314344d198418cff07bd21e

4 Input
2 Outputs
  • 51b56c734b002fc1e91702e4a2b9c3b0bb55b51fa314344d198418cff07bd21e:0
  • value  885023
    address  1NiMrWgNc4DgtRzCLRESuMDKAh3amQ4Vfj
  • 51b56c734b002fc1e91702e4a2b9c3b0bb55b51fa314344d198418cff07bd21e:1
  • value  10300000
    address  3BMEX1UviQdeLG2tKVGFUH3VF6vo5zAj9K